Which MP3 player is actually the killer iPod of Zune
iPod killer was the claim made in November 2006 when Zune was launched by Microsoft. The Zune is a digital media player made for Microsoft by Toshiba. Video and podcast stores as well as online music will be provided by the new software which includes the Zune Marketplace.
Zune has a few features that they thought would help them overtake iPod in the market but and although the features are good they did not reckon with the faithful followers of iPod. Zune’s great new features include FM radio built in as well as the wireless ability to transfer songs to other Zune’s and Window’s PC,s. You can rip audio CDs, buy TV shows and video music and songs and manage files using Zunes software on Windows XP and Vista.
Zune’s advantages over iPod
The first Zune was released with a 30GB memory. The player although larger and heavier than iPod’s 30GB issue, has a bright colour screen that is half an inch larger than the iPod’s.
Zune supports unprotected AAC files which is better than using the default settings for ripping CD’s with the iPod and the FM tuner should give it a big advantage over the apple iPod.
Portable medial players forged new frontiers when Zune came out with connectivity to Wi-Fi. Using the Wi-Fi feature will open up a new music socialising universe. The portability is attractive to younger people who want to exchange songs with there friends.
The integrated Zune Marketplace is subscription based and enables users to access an online database of new music without having to download it first to your computer. The ability to download as many songs as you want for a flat fee is another important aspect.
Other advantages are it is easy to use the interface combines horizontal and vertical scrolling, with many top-level menus displaying horizontally across the top of the screen, while lists of tracks or track information run vertically. Generally much faster than the iPod the Zune interface runs almost instantaneously through the tracks playlist and shuffle play. Zune’s central select button on there main control is touch sensitive and it also has a four-position directional control.
Zunes larger display screen makes a big difference over the course of extended viewing and also boasts great quality audio, with clear and crisp video. Synchronizing nicely with windows media centre it has tons of cool features. Because Zune also works with Xbox 360 most people think it’s fun to use.
iPod’s advantages over Zune.
As we have already spoken about it the Zune is heavier and larger than the iPod.
Problems with Zune’s early models saw lots of firmware updates needed. And quite a few people had reservations about Microsoft’s Digital Rights Management policy.
The Electronic Frontier Foundation, in opposition to the Zune’s DRM, wrote:
“ Microsoft’s Zune will not play protected Windows Media Audio and Video purchased or ‘rented’ from Napster 2.0, Rhapsody, Yahoo! Unlimited, Movielink, Cinemanow, iTunes, or any other online media service. The Zune will not even play content previously purchased from Microsoft’s own MSN Music service. …The media that Microsoft promised would Play For Sure doesn’t even play on Microsoft’s own device.”
The following year saw less strict DRM from Microsoft and the allowed about 1/3 more tracks to be without it.
Zune like rival iPod will only be compatible with its own software provided by Microsoft’s from September 2008.
Another problem is when you receive a song from a friend as you are only allowed to listen to it three times before it will expire. You cannot resend it to a third party.
Zune Marketplace is not easy to use and iTunes is a much simpler option. Simple and elegant to use iTunes is also very intuitive. Just a click lets you pay your 99 cents with iTunes for a song using your credit card. You have to buy at the very least $5 of points when buying from the Zune Marketplace. So if you only need one 99cent song Microsoft are holding onto your other $4.1 until you want to purchase another song. The point system itself is not easy. One song will cost you 79 points which you may think is cents while the actual 79 points costs 99cents. Microsoft have complicated the easy process of buying music?
So can iPod be overtaken by Zune?
This brings us to the question can Zune overtake iPod. Well a recent survey from Piper Jaffray’s bi-annual teen survey showed that Apple’s share of the portable media player market among high school students increased to 84 percent, it was 80 percent a year ago. 78% said that if they where going to buy a MP3 player then it would be an iPod. Last year Zune commanded 2% of the market which has increased to 3% this year. Now 15% of the teen’s surveyed plan to buy a Zune if they purchase within the next year. This is up from 13% last year.
So it looks like the Zune is progressing in the MP3 player market but not at a rate that will cause the Apple iPod and problems in the near future. Another thought that goes agains Zune is that lots of young folk use Macs which Zune does not support.
